Localizando pacotes de Windows Installer

Ferramentas de implantação da Visual Studio incluem vários recursos que permitem que você distribua várias versões do seu aplicativo para localidades diferentes. Você precisará criar um instalador separado para cada versão localizada do seu aplicativo; não é possível criar um único instalador para várias localidades.

Dica

Se os arquivos principais do aplicativo são as mesmas para todas as localidades, considere a possibilidade de colocar os arquivos principais em um módulo de mesclagem e adicionar o módulo de mesclagem mais quaisquer arquivos específicos da localidade para o instalador para cada localidade. Configurações do registro, ações personalizadas e os tipos de arquivo podem ser definidos no projeto de módulo de mesclagem para que você não precisa recriá-los para cada projeto.

Para criar um instalador localizado, você definir a localização propriedade do projeto de implantação para um dos idiomas suportados (listado na lista drop-down a Propriedades janela). O localização propriedade determina o idioma para o texto padrão exibido nas caixas de diálogo de interface de usuário instalação durante a instalação. Você não conseguir ver o texto traduzido no IDE; Você só poderá ver o texto traduzido por construir e executar o instalador.

Texto que é fornecido pelas propriedades não é traduzido. Por exemplo, o ProductName propriedade determina o nome que é exibido na barra de título das caixas de diálogo de instalação. Você precisará inserir o localizadas ProductName na Propriedades janela para cada projeto de implantação localizadas. Outras propriedades do projeto de implantação que talvez precise ser localizadas incluem o Autor, Descrição, palavras-chave, fabricante, ManufacturerUrl, assunto, SupportPhone, SupportUrl, e título propriedades. Se a AddRemoveProgramsIcon propriedade especifica um ícone de texto, talvez você queira especificar um ícone localizado bem.

ObservaçãoObservação

Texto para propriedades de implantação deve ser inserido com o uso de caracteres da página de código para a localidade de destino ou ocorrerá um erro de compilação. As páginas de código com suporte para implantação são: 1252 (Neutro, inglês, francês, alemão, italiano e espanhol), 936 (chinês (simplificado)), 950 (chinês (tradicional),) 932 (japonês) e 949 (coreano).

Propriedades adicionais que talvez precise ser localizadas incluem o nome e Descrição propriedades para os atalhos no File System Editor, o nome e Descrição propriedades para tipos de arquivo e ações no File Types Editore o mensagem propriedade para condições na Iniciar o Editor de condições.

ObservaçãoObservação

Para instaladores localizadas, o texto padrão para o CopyrightWarning e WelcomeText propriedades serão exibidas durante a instalação no idioma especificado do projeto localização propriedade, não no idioma exibido no Propriedades janela. Se o CopyrightWarning ou WelcomeText propriedade foi alterada, o texto exibido na Propriedades janela será exibida durante a instalação; Você deve inserir o texto no idioma localizado.

Consulte também

Referência

Propriedadesde implantação

Propriedade de localização

Conceitos

Conjuntos de caracteres em C++

Outros recursos

Globalizando e Localizando Aplicativos